Peter was just an ordinary schoolboy, but he had a kind heart that shone through in everything he did. Despite his studies, he always looked for ways to help people around him. So, when he heard that the local newspaper was looking for a paperboy, he jumped at the opportunity to take the job.

The work was tough, especially for a young boy like him. He had to wake up early in the morning, bundle up the newspapers, and deliver them to different parts of the neighborhood. But Peter never complained. He knew that the people who relied on the newspaper for their daily dose of information were counting on him to do his job.

One day, while on his paper route, Peter noticed an elderly woman who was struggling with her groceries. Without hesitation, he put down his bundle of newspapers and rushed over to help her. He carried her bags to her doorstep and made sure she was safely inside before continuing on his route.

The next day, the woman called the newspaper office to tell them what Peter had done. She explained that she had been having a difficult time lately, and his small act of kindness had made all the difference in the world to her. The newspaper editor was so impressed that he decided to feature Peter in the paper, commending him for his selflessness and his commitment to his job.

Peter was surprised and a little embarrassed by all the attention, but he was also proud. He realized that even the smallest act of kindness can have a significant impact on someone's life. He continued to deliver the newspapers with the same enthusiasm and dedication as before, but now he also made a conscious effort to look for ways to help others along the way.

The message of Peter's story is simple but powerful: kindness can make a real difference in people's lives, no matter how small the act. It's a message that we can all learn from and put into practice, especially in these challenging times when so many people are struggling. If we all take a moment to look out for one another, the world would be a better place.

Over time, Peter's reputation as a kind-hearted paperboy grew. People started to look forward to seeing him every morning, not just for their newspaper but also for the small acts of kindness he would perform along the way. Some days he would pick up litter on the sidewalk, other days he would help people carry their groceries, and sometimes he would simply stop to chat with someone who looked like they needed a friendly face.

His kindness even extended to his customers. On days when the weather was particularly bad, he would take extra care to make sure the newspapers were delivered to the doorstep, instead of just tossing them on the lawn. He knew that for some elderly or disabled customers, a wet newspaper could be the difference between starting their day with a smile or feeling discouraged.

One day, as Peter was delivering the newspapers, he heard a cry for help coming from a nearby alley. Without hesitation, he dropped his newspapers and ran towards the sound. As he turned the corner, he saw a young girl being harassed by two boys. Peter didn't hesitate. He stepped in and bravely confronted the bullies, diffusing the situation and helping the girl to safety.

As news of his heroic act spread, Peter became a local hero. People praised him for his bravery and his kindness, and many young children looked up to him as a role model. But for Peter, it was just another day of trying to make the world a better place, one small act of kindness at a time.

In the end, Peter's part-time job as a paperboy taught him some valuable lessons about the importance of kindness, compassion, and empathy. He learned that even the smallest act of kindness can have a significant impact on someone's life, and that by looking out for one another, we can create a more caring and supportive community.

And as he grew older and moved on to bigger things, he never forgot the lessons he had learned as a paperboy. He continued to be a kind-hearted person, always looking for ways to help those around him, and inspiring others to do the same.

Years later, as Peter looked back on his days as a paperboy, he realized that the experience had shaped him in many ways. He had learned valuable life skills, such as time management, responsibility, and accountability, that had helped him to excel in his academic and professional pursuits.

But more importantly, the experience had taught him to value the small things in life, and to appreciate the power of human connection. It had taught him that even the most seemingly insignificant interactions could have a profound impact on someone's life, and that by reaching out to others with kindness and compassion, we could all make a difference.

Peter became a successful businessman, but he never lost sight of the importance of giving back to his community. He continued to volunteer his time and resources to various causes, always striving to make a positive impact on the world around him.

As he grew older and looked back on his life, he realized that being a paperboy had been more than just a part-time job. It had been a transformative experience that had helped him to become the person he was today: a kind-hearted, compassionate, and resilient individual who had never lost sight of the power of human connection. And he was grateful for every moment of it.
